STEM + Health Graduate Fellowship, 4 – 9 months in France! Due January 31, 2014

  The STEM Chateaubriand Fellowship targets outstanding PhD students enrolled in an American university who wish to conduct part of their doctoral research in a French laboratory for a 4 to 9 month period. The Office of Science and Technology provide a stipend of up to 1,400 €/month (depending on other sources of funding) and coverContinue reading “STEM + Health Graduate Fellowship, 4 – 9 months in France!
